Reactions of Dihydrido(bicarbonato)bis(triisopropylphosphine)rhodium(III) with Alkynes. Formation of Rh2H2(O2CO)(PhCCPh)(P(i-Pr)3)3 and the Stereoselective Hydrogenation of Alkynes to Trans Olefins

A recation of RhH2(O2COH)(P(i-Pr)3)2 (1) with PhCCPh has been found to give trans-stilbene and a novel binuclear rhodium complex Rh2H2(O2CO)(PhCCPh)(P(i-Pr)3)3 (2).A similar reaction with MeO2CCCCO2Me results both in H2 evolution and half-hydrogenation, while with F3CCCCF3 only H2 evolution is observed.Compound 1 catalyzes the stereoselective half-hydrogenation of alkynes to trans olefins.Complex 2 crystallizes in the monoclinic space group C52h-P21/c, with four formula units in a cell of dimensions a = 17.158 (4) Angstroem, b = 23.916 (3) Angstroem, c = 11.255 (3) Angstroem, β = 103.3 (1) deg, and V = 4494 Angstroem3 (t ca. -160 deg C).In the solid state 2 consists of a distorted octahedral Rh(III) center and a distorted square-planar Rh(I) center bridged by a bis-bidentate carbonato group.
